Bus station hiking trails around Forst Schmalwasser-Süd offer access to the diverse landscapes of Lower Franconia, Bavaria. The region is characterized by its extensive forest areas, rolling hills, and the presence of the Premich river. Hikers can explore a network of paths that traverse varied terrain, including woodlands and open areas, providing opportunities for different activity levels.

The Kreuzberg is the biggest visitor magnet in the Bavarian Rhön. All year round, the Franciscan monastery Kreuzberg with its monastery beer attracts holidaymakers from near and far to the Holy Mountain of the Franconians. After a strengthening meal in the monastery tavern, the ascent to the summit of the Kreuzberg can be managed, from where you get a magnificent view into the Southern Rhön, the Hessian Rhön and the Thuringian Forest. Frequently Asked Questions

How many bus station hiking trails are available in Forest Schmalwasser-Süd?

There are over 570 hiking routes accessible from bus stations in Forest Schmalwasser-Süd. This includes 275 easy, 257 moderate, and 43 difficult trails, offering a wide range of options for all fitness levels.

Are there any easy circular routes starting from a bus stop?

Yes, for an easy circular route, consider the Marian grotto in Schmalwasser – Schmalwasser Church loop. This 6.1 km trail is rated easy and offers a pleasant walk through the local scenery.

What kind of natural features or landmarks can I expect to see on these trails?

The trails in Forest Schmalwasser-Süd offer a connection with nature and historical markers. You might encounter the ancient Dancing Oak, a significant natural monument, or enjoy quiet paths like the ST2267 Road Along the Premich. Many routes also pass by charming religious sites such as the Sänner Chapel and View of the Black Mountains.

Are there any moderate hikes that offer good views?

For a moderate hike with scenic vistas, try the View of Kreuzberg – View of Kreuzberg loop. This 9.3 km route provides rewarding views of the Kreuzberg area.

What do other hikers say about the trails in Forest Schmalwasser-Süd?

The komoot community highly rates the hiking experience in Forest Schmalwasser-Süd, with an average score of 4.6 out of 5 stars from over 11,200 ratings. Hikers often praise the diverse trails, accessible natural beauty, and well-maintained paths suitable for various skill levels.

Are there any longer, more challenging routes for experienced hikers?

Yes, if you're looking for a more demanding adventure, the Gemündener Hut – Kreuzberg Monastery loop is a difficult 24.1 km trail. It offers a substantial challenge with significant elevation changes, leading to the historic Kreuzberg Monastery.

Can I find family-friendly routes accessible by bus?

Many of the easy and moderate trails are suitable for families. The region is known for its accessible natural beauty, with routes like the 5.72 km 'Wayside Shrine with Bench – Singletrack just before Premich loop' (mentioned in region research) offering a good option for shorter excursions with children.

Are there any routes that pass by interesting cultural or historical points?

Absolutely. The region is dotted with historical markers and cultural sites. For example, the View of Kreuzberg – Marian grotto in Schmalwasser loop combines scenic views with a visit to the Marian grotto, offering a blend of nature and local heritage.

What is the best time of year to hike in Forest Schmalwasser-Süd?

Forest Schmalwasser-Süd offers a delightful way to connect with nature on foot throughout much of the year. Spring and autumn provide pleasant temperatures and beautiful foliage, while summer is ideal for longer days. Even in winter, some well-maintained paths can be enjoyed, though conditions may vary.

Are there any huts or shelters along the bus station trails?

Yes, some routes may pass by or near facilities. For instance, the Pfiffshütte is a highlight in the area, which could be a point of interest or a resting spot on certain trails.

Are there any moderate loop trails that explore different parts of the forest?

Consider the Marian grotto in Schmalwasser – At the Schwarzfluss loop. This moderate 8.4 km route takes you through varied forest landscapes, offering a good exploration of the area around the Schwarzfluss.
